The machine will be ready for use about 2 minutes after it is turned on The maximum quantity of coffee that is pos sible to make is of about 50 ml WARNING The first time you use the appli ance it is important to do a washing cycle us ing the empty capsules provided as described in the MAINTENANCE section MAKING COFFEE e Put a cup under the coffee dispenser 6 The coffee dispenser 6 may be removed for cleaning or when using a recipient taller than an espresso cup Follow the instruc tions in the MAINTENANCE section to re move it Open the capsule compartment door 7a and put a capsule in the compartment 7 in the position suggested by its shape fig 2 Close the door pushing it all the way e WARNING the capsule is automatically pushed into the compartment when the door 7a is closed pushing it as far as it will go Never push the capsule in with your fingers Press the dispenser switch 8 to have the coffee come out after a while When you have the desired quantity of coffee press the switch 8 again to stop dispensing In this way you can make longer or shorter coffee as you wish by controlling the amount dispensed s The used capsule automatically falls into the collection drawer 9 when a new one is placed in the compartment 7 Empty the used capsules drawer fre quently to ensure that used capsules do not block the exit passage NOTE before switching on the app

7. liance at the switch 8 make sure that you have in serted the capsule for the drink you wish to make or an empty capsule if you intend to clean the appliance If you have not placed any capsule in it the water that is dispensed will not come out of the coffee dispenser 6 but fall into the used capsules drawer 9 MAINTENANCE Always unplug the appliance before per forming any maintenance operations Clean the outside of the appliance with a damp cloth only Never use solvents or de tergents as they could damage the plastic surface e Clean the coffee dispenser 6 periodically and whenever the machine has not been used for a long time To remove it from the appliance turn it clockwise as far as it will go and remove it from its housing fig 3 Rinse it in running water and put it back on the ap pliance Use the empty capsules provided in the package to clean the infusion parts of the machine at least every 2 or 3 days This op eration must not be performed using the same capsule more than five times When you have finished using all the empty cap 20 ESPRESSO sules provided about 10 cleaning cycles you can use a used coffee capsule instead Simply remove the paper that seals the capsule then empty and clean the capsule Clean the machine by operating it as you would for making a drink pouring the same amount of water used to make a cup of coffee RECOMMENDATION Place a dish un derneath the
8. materials making up the prod uct For more information on available collec tion facilities contact your local waste collec tion service or the shop where you bought this appliance THE CAPSULE SYSTEM The machine is designed exclusively for use with the Aroma Polti capsule system Each capsule contains just the right amount and just the right grind to obtain the best espresso coffee in a few seconds The wrapper on the capsule is made of polypropylene an excel lent material for use in contact with foodstuff It is hygienic convenient and very resistant to high temperatures The capsule system is not only very convenient 19 ENGLISH ENGLISH ESPRESSO and easy to use it guarantees all the freshness and aroma of freshly roasted coffee so that you can enjoy your favourite blend Use with capsules other than Aroma Polti capsules will result in forfeiture of the warranty SET UP PREPARATION OF THE MACHINE Carefully remove the machine and the ac cessories from the package Open the lid remove the water reservoir 1 fig 1 and wash it with clean cold water e Fill the reservoir 1 with clean cold water only put it back into the machine and close the lid Do not fill the reservoir with carbonated wa ter or any other liquid s Insert the power cable plug 10 into a suitable earthed socket Turn on the appliance by pressing the main switch 3 The ON OFF indicator light will come on 4
